5.10.29 Creating a Curve for a Wire Winding Machine
1. Motion control function block
The motion control function block T-Winding is used to create a curve for a wire winding machine.
Concept

The winding of a coil is shown above. The slave axis specified turns clockwise in the right direction (A).
The slave axis sends pulses until the number of rings forming a layer is reached (B). The slave axis
turns counterclockwise in the negative position, and sends pulses until the number of rings forming a
layer is reached (C). The number of rings which forms a layer when the slave axis turns clockwise in
the right direction is equal to the number of rings which form a layer when the slave axis turns
counterclockwise in the negative position. The slave axis turns clockwise in the right direction, and
turns counterclockwise in the negative position. It winds wires around the master axis specified. As a
result, the electronic cam curve created needs to show that the slave axis moves from one end of the
master axis to the other end of the master axis, and then returns. The relation between the slave axis
and the master axis can be shown by only three points in the electronic cam curve. The values of the
parameters in the table below can be used to create an electronic cam curve.
